<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-paid-subscriptions-amp-platform-creator-tools"><strong>Paid Subscriptions &amp; Platform Creator Tools</strong></h3>



<p>Every method we&#8217;ve covered so far depends on brands paying you. This one flips the script. Paid subscriptions let you earn directly from your audience — recurring revenue that shows up monthly, not just when a deal lands in your inbox. That&#8217;s a different kind of freedom.</p>



<p>The major platforms have all built out subscription and monetization features: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Instagram Subscriptions</strong> — followers pay a monthly fee for exclusive content, stories, and lives.</li>



<li><strong>YouTube Memberships</strong> — subscribers get perks like badges, behind-the-scenes content, and early access to videos.</li>



<li><strong>TikTok Series</strong> — creators can put premium content behind a paywall for followers willing to pay for deeper dives.</li>
</ul>



<p>Beyond subscriptions, platforms also pay creators through ad revenue and creator funds — though the models differ. YouTube AdSense is a revenue share that scales with your views, while most creator funds (like TikTok&#8217;s Creator Rewards) pull from a fixed pool, making payouts less predictable. On TikTok, only videos over 60 seconds qualify for the Rewards Program — worth knowing if you&#8217;re mainly posting short clips. These payouts won&#8217;t replace a full income on their own, but stacked alongside brand deals and affiliate earnings, they add up.&nbsp;</p>



<p><em>A quick heads-up: not all of these features are available in every region, and the same goes for direct creator payouts. Check each platform&#8217;s eligibility requirements for your country before building a strategy around them.</em></p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="whitelisting">1. Whitelisting</h3>



<p>Influencer whitelisting allows brands to convert Influencers’ content—posts, stories, reels, and more—into paid ads running from the Influencers’ accounts. Unlike mainstream advertising, brands can post these ads directly from an Influencer’s profile.</p>



<p>Since the target audience is already invested in the Influencer&#8217;s content, whitelisted ads will receive better engagement and reach. Besides, brands can also maximize the ROI by defining the audience they want to target and optimizing the content through A/B testing.</p>



<p>Here’s the perfect example of Influencer whitelisting by Florida Crystals. Their Collaboration with Influencer Priyanka Naik went out as a paid partnership reel on her account. The organic sugar brand then pushed out this reel as a whitelisted ad to get more eyes to the post and generate more brand awareness.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="750" height="532" src="https://af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/priyanka-naik-florida-crystals-influencer-collab.jpg" alt="Priyanka Naik IG collab post with Florida Crystals" class="wp-image-19985"/></figure>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-best-practices-for-influencer-whitelisting">Best practices for Influencer whitelisting</h4>



<p>Here are a few handy tips for whitelisting Influencer content and running profitable ads: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Find relevant Influencers</strong>: Choose Influencers who best represent your brand personality and vision. Use Influencer databases like <a href="https://afluencer.com/#/influencers"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ener"><strong>Afluencer</strong></a> to browse a collection of Influencers from different niches and channels before picking the best fit.</li>
</ul>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Establish meaningful Influencer relationships</strong>: Trust lies at the core of Influencer whitelisting—Influencers should trust a brand enough to grant permission to run ads from their personal accounts. So, focus on nurturing a healthy relationship with your Influencers to pitch a whitelisting campaign.</li>
</ul>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Communicate expectations transparently</strong>: Give Influencers all the information they need before you run ads from their account. Clarify your expectations and workflows to ensure there are no misunderstandings once the campaign is underway.</li>
</ul>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Define a content strategy beforehand</strong>: Finalize the core messaging, content formats, and campaign goals before allowing Influencers to create content. A targeted content strategy can help you reach the right audience and get more from your campaign.</li>
</ul>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Optimize content with A/B testing</strong>: Whitelisting ads means you control how the ads look and feel. Optimize your ad content by testing and modifying the format, design, CTA placement, and other elements.</li>
</ul>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="giveaways">4. UGC challenges &amp; Gamified campaigns</h3>



<p>Traditional giveaways and loop contests are becoming less effective as audiences grow more skeptical of low-effort incentives. Instead, brands are shifting toward <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=hVrBhPbyjZM"><strong>UGC</strong></a> challenges and gamified campaigns that encourage meaningful participation.</p>



<p>Rather than asking users to tag friends or follow multiple accounts, these collaborations invite creators to actively participate in a shared challenge. This might include creating content around a theme, completing a simple task, or showcasing how a product fits into everyday life.</p>



<p>UGC challenges work well because they: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Encourage authentic, creator-led content<br></li>



<li>Attract higher-quality engagement<br></li>



<li>Reduce bot activity and low-intent followers<br></li>



<li>Create momentum beyond a single post<br></li>
</ul>



<p>For example, the <strong>GoPro Million Dollar Challenge</strong> is an annual campaign where users submit footage shot on the brand&#8217;s latest camera for a chance to be featured in a global highlight reel. If a user&#8217;s clip is selected, they earn an equal share of a $1 million prize pool (for example, in recent years, winners received roughly $18,000 to $22,000 each).&nbsp;</p>



<p>The challenge provides the GoPro with a massive library of high-quality, authentic marketing content at a fraction of the cost of a professional shoot. By requiring footage from the newest camera model, it effectively crowdsources &#8220;social proof&#8221; that demonstrates the product&#8217;s capabilities in real-world scenarios. Ultimately, it turns customers into active brand advocates while fostering deep community loyalty through a high-stakes, collaborative reward system. </p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="526" height="760" src="https://cache.af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/Screenshot-2026-01-24-160238.png" alt="" class="wp-image-28799"/></figure>



<p>Gamification can be as simple as creator spotlights, featured content, or tiered rewards based on participation. The focus shifts from “winning” to contributing, which feels more aligned with how creators and audiences engage today. </p>



<p><strong>Why it works:</strong> Instead of buying short-term attention, brands generate dozens or even hundreds of pieces of user-generated content. This creates a reusable library of social proof that can be repurposed across marketing channels, including paid ads, long after the campaign ends.</p>



<p>This collaboration style is particularly effective with nano and micro-influencers, where community participation and relatability matter more than reach.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-influencer-collaboration-tips-for-mastering-influencer-negotiation-for-better-deals"><strong>Influencer Collaboration Tips for Mastering Influencer Negotiation for Better Deals</strong> </h2>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="720" height="560" src="https://cache.af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/influencer-collaboration-tips-2.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-28092"/></figure>



<p>Landing a Collab is exciting. But before you say “yes,” make sure the terms work for you. Smart influencer negotiation turns free products into paid influencer brand partnerships that respect your time, skills, and audience value.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-1-know-your-value"><strong>1. Know Your Value </strong></h4>



<p>Before you <a href="https://afluencer.com/what-are-influencer-marketing-rates-a-comprehensive-definition/"><strong>talk numbers</strong></a>, be clear on what you bring to the table. Think about your engagement rate, audience size, content quality, and niche authority. Brands pay for influence, not just follower count.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-2-start-with-gratitude-then-clarify"><strong>2. Start with Gratitude, Then Clarify</strong> </h4>



<p>Thank the brand for the opportunity. Then ask questions about expectations — number of posts, deadlines, usage rights, exclusivity periods, and payment terms.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-3-offer-packages-instead-of-a-single-rate"><strong>3. Offer Packages Instead of a Single Rate </strong></h4>



<p>Give options. For example: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Product Only:</strong> 1 Reel + 1 Story<br></li>



<li><strong>Paid Package 1:</strong> 1 Reel + 1 Story + 1 Carousel = $X<br></li>



<li><strong>Paid Package 2:</strong> 2 Reels + 3 Stories + Content Usage Rights = $X<br></li>
</ul>



<p>This makes it easier for the brand to choose a budget-friendly option while still paying for your work.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-4-suggest-a-small-test-package"><strong>4. Suggest a Small Test Package </strong></h4>



<p>If a brand is unsure, propose a trial campaign. For example:<br>“How about we start with 1 Reel + 1 Story for $150, plus the gifted product? If the results are great, we can expand from there.”</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-5-turn-free-product-into-a-paid-bundle"><strong>5. Turn “Free Product” Into a Paid Bundle </strong></h4>



<p>If they’re set on gifting, position the product as part of the payment:<br>“Your $200 product plus a $100 flat fee would be a fair starting point for this campaign.” </p>



<p>Each of these steps builds trust and shows the brand you’re serious about delivering value — not just accepting freebies.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-6-highlight-the-roi"><strong>6. Highlight the ROI </strong></h4>



<p>Tie your rate to potential results. If you’ve boosted sales, grown engagement, or increased brand awareness in past campaigns, share those wins. This strengthens your influencer negotiation position and justifies higher rates.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-7-be-ready-to-walk-away-politely"><strong>7. Be Ready to Walk Away — Politely </strong></h4>



<p>Sometimes the best negotiation tool is showing you have limited spots and prioritizing paid influencer brand partnerships. This signals confidence and professionalism.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-8-put-it-in-writing"><strong>8. Put It in Writing </strong></h4>



<p>Once you agree on terms, get a contract. Even for small partnerships, a contract protects both sides.</p>



<p><strong>Pro tip:</strong> If a brand says they don’t have budget now, stay polite. Keep them on your list and check back later — budgets change, and a free Collab today could lead to a paid one tomorrow. </p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Benchmarks: What Does Good Influencer Marketing ROI Look Like?</strong> </h2>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1256" height="924" src="https://cache.af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/diana-polekhina-iUfusOthmgQ-unsplash.jpg" alt="Influencer Marketing ROI in 2025: Benchmarks" class="wp-image-28014" srcset="https://af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/diana-polekhina-iUfusOthmgQ-unsplash.jpg 1256w, https://af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/diana-polekhina-iUfusOthmgQ-unsplash-768x565.jpg 768w, https://afluencer.com/wp-content/uploads/diana-polekhina-iUfusOthmgQ-unsplash-1536x1130.jpg 1536w" sizes="(max-width: 1256px) 100vw, 1256px" /></figure>



<p>So you&#8217;re tracking metrics. But how do you know if the numbers are <em>good</em>?</p>



<p>That’s where benchmarks help.</p>



<p>Influencer marketing ROI isn’t one-size-fits-all. Here’s a quick <a href="https://influencity.com/blog/en/what-is-a-good-engagement-rate">engagement breakdown</a> to give you a starting point: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Under 1%:</strong> Interaction is low. It may be time to rethink your content or revisit the influencers you’re working with.<br></li>



<li><strong>1% to 3%:</strong> This is a healthy range.<br></li>



<li><strong>3% to 5%:</strong> Great engagement. Your audience isn’t just watching—they’re responding.<br></li>



<li><strong>Over 5%:</strong> You’ve hit gold. This kind of engagement means your content is connecting deeply and driving real interest.<br></li>
</ul>



<p>Now let’s break it down even further. Note that rates vary significantly depending on the social media platform. </p>



<div style="height:20px" aria-hidden="true" class="wp-block-spacer"></div>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Engagement Rate Benchmarks</strong></h4>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Nano influencers:</strong> <a href="https://www.shopify.com/blog/influencer-marketing-statistics">4–8%<br></a></li>



<li><strong>Micro influencers:</strong> <a href="https://thesocialcat.com/blog/influencer-marketing-report">2%</a>–4%<br></li>



<li><strong>Mid-tier &amp;influencers:</strong> <a href="https://thesocialcat.com/blog/influencer-marketing-report">1%–3%</a> </li>



<li><strong>Macro &amp; mega influencers: 1% </strong><a href="https://sproutsocial.com/insights/instagram-engagement-rate/#:~:text=in%20your%20industry.-,What%20is%20a%20good%20influencer%20engagement%20rate%20on%20Instagram?,health%20influencers%20dropped%20to%200.4%25."><strong>or less</strong></a></li>
</ul>



<p>Higher engagement usually means a more connected audience—and stronger ROI. </p>



<div style="height:20px" aria-hidden="true" class="wp-block-spacer"></div>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Click‑Through Rate (CTR)</strong></h4>



<p>A strong CTR shows that people aren’t just seeing the content—they’re taking action.</p>



<p>What counts as “good” depends on a few factors: platform, content type, and even your niche. But in general, if you’re beating the industry average, you’re on the right track.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>A CTR of <strong>1.5%–2.5%</strong> is a solid benchmark for influencer-driven links<br></li>



<li>Anything over <strong>2%</strong> is considered strong performance<br></li>
</ul>



<p>Higher CTRs often mean the content felt relevant, the CTA was clear, and the offer was compelling. And that adds up to better influencer marketing ROI. </p>



<div style="height:20px" aria-hidden="true" class="wp-block-spacer"></div>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Conversion Rate</strong></h4>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>2%–5%</strong> is standard for eCommerce<br></li>



<li>Higher if you&#8217;re offering a discount or limited-time offer<br></li>
</ul>



<p>Lower conversions? Check your landing page or CTA. </p>



<div style="height:20px" aria-hidden="true" class="wp-block-spacer"></div>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Return on Ad Spend (ROAS)</strong></h4>



<p>If you’re <a href="https://afluencer.com/influencer-rates/"><strong>paying influencers</strong></a>, aim for at least <strong>3:1</strong>. That means for every $1 spent, you made $3 back.</p>



<p>More niche brands may be happy with a <strong>2:1</strong> ratio—especially when content is also repurposed.</p>



<p>Remember: good influencer marketing ROI depends on your goals, your niche, and your budget. Compare results over time, not just one-off numbers. </p>
